单词 admarginate
释义

admarginatev.

Brit. /adˈmɑːdʒɪneɪt/, U.S. /ædˈmɑrdʒɪˌneɪt/
Origin: A borrowing from Latin, combined with English elements; probably modelled on a Latin lexical item. Etymons: ad- prefix, Latin margin- , margō , -ate suffix3.
Etymology: < ad- prefix + classical Latin margin-, margō edge, border (see margin n.) + -ate suffix3, probably after post-classical Latin ad marginem (of notes) in the margin (1519 or earlier; compare earlier (in the same sense) in margine (from c1125 in British sources)). Compare earlier marginate v. 1 (only in the 17th cent. in this sense) and later margination n. 2. Compare also earlier marginalize v. 1, marginal adj. 1, and marginalia n.
rare.
transitive. To add or note in the margin; (also) to make notes in the margins of (a book).

a1834 S. T. Coleridge Lit. Remains (1838) III. 298 Receive candidly the few hints which I have admarginated for your assistance.
1868 D. W. Poor tr. C. F. Kling First Epist. Paul to Corinthians 107 It might as easily have been omitted for the sake of avoiding the repetition,..as admarginated [Ger. beigeschrieben].
1903 Gunton's Mag. Nov. 432 Through it moves slowly the aloof..figure of the young noble, Odo Valsecca..his book of thought too freely admarginated for uncomplicated guidance.
2010 inamidst.com 10 Aug. (O.E.D. Archive) Anatomy of Melancholy, another book Coleridge perused and admarginated.
